Effect of support type on the magnitude of synergism and promotion in CoMo sulphide hydrodesulphurisation catalyst

The Co, Mo and CoMo catalysts in different COMO ratios supported on SiO2, ZrO2, TiO2, Al2O3, active carbon and MgO were prepared. The catalysts were tested in the hydrodesulphurisation of benzothiophene. The order of activity of monometallic Mo catalysts was MoO3/ TiO2 > MoO3/C > MoO3/ZrO2 > MoO3/SiO2 > MoO3/Al2O3 > MoO3/MgO. The order of promotion of MoO3/support by Co addition was CoMo/MgO > CoMo/C > CoMo/Al2O3 > CoMo/TiO2 > COMO/ZrO2 > COMO/SiO2. The synergism in activity was accompanied with a decrease of hydrogenation/hydrogenolysis selectivity. Hydrogenolysis was promoted more than hydrogenation and thus less dihydrobenzothiophene was formed on COMO than on Co and Mo catalysts. The TPR patterns were measured, and the degree of reduction correlated with the activity of monometallic catalysts. The TPR patterns of COMO catalysts were similar to the patterns of Mo catalysts, and no correlation with magnitude of promotion was found. (C) 2007 Elsevier B.V. All rights reserved.
